How much does an EHR Application Analyst III make in Atlanta, GA?

As of April 01, 2025, the average annual salary for an EHR Application Analyst III in Atlanta, GA is $117,410. Salary.com reports that pay typically ranges from $110,030 to $123,500, with most professionals earning between $103,311 and $129,045.

75th Percentile $123,500 $10,292 $2,375 $59
Average $117,410 $9,784 $2,258 $56
25th Percentile $110,030 $9,169 $2,116 $53

Levels Salary
Entry Level EHR Application Analyst III $114,985
Intermediate Level EHR Application Analyst III $115,535
Senior Level EHR Application Analyst III $116,306
Specialist Level EHR Application Analyst III $117,588
Expert Level EHR Application Analyst III $119,406
